Self-organized Structure Generated by Molecular Symmetry/Asymmetry Regulation

Keisuke Kaneda, Kazuhiro Shikinaka, Nozomu Fujii, Keiichi Noguchi, Eiji Masai, Yoshihiro Katayama, Masaya Nakamura, Yuichiro Otsuka, Seiji Ohara, Kiyotaka Shigehara

Open publisher page 0 citations

Abstract

Abstract The self-organization of polyfunctional molecules, leading to specific molecular assemblies, is often determined by the molecular symmetry/asymmetry of constitution. By using structurally isomeric pyronedicarboxylic acids, the molecular symmetry/asymmetry was revealed to discriminate the structure and the thermodynamic stability of self-organized architecture.
